+static struct spoolss_security_descriptor *winreg_printer_create_default_secdesc(TALLOC_CTX *ctx)
+{
+       SEC_ACE ace[5]; /* max number of ace entries */
+       int i = 0;
+       uint32_t sa;
+       SEC_ACL *psa = NULL;
+       SEC_DESC *psd = NULL;
+       DOM_SID adm_sid;
+       size_t sd_size;
+
+       /* Create an ACE where Everyone is allowed to print */
+
+       sa = PRINTER_ACE_PRINT;
+       init_sec_ace(&ace[i++], &global_sid_World, SEC_ACE_TYPE_ACCESS_ALLOWED,
+                    sa, SEC_ACE_FLAG_CONTAINER_INHERIT);
+
+       /* Add the domain admins group if we are a DC */
+
+       if ( IS_DC ) {
+               DOM_SID domadmins_sid;
+
+               sid_compose(&domadmins_sid, get_global_sam_sid(),
+                           DOMAIN_GROUP_RID_ADMINS);
+
+               sa = PRINTER_ACE_FULL_CONTROL;
+               init_sec_ace(&ace[i++], &domadmins_sid,
+                       SEC_ACE_TYPE_ACCESS_ALLOWED, sa,
+                       SEC_ACE_FLAG_OBJECT_INHERIT | SEC_ACE_FLAG_INHERIT_ONLY);
+               init_sec_ace(&ace[i++], &domadmins_sid, SEC_ACE_TYPE_ACCESS_ALLOWED,
+                       sa, SEC_ACE_FLAG_CONTAINER_INHERIT);
+       }
+       else if (secrets_fetch_domain_sid(lp_workgroup(), &adm_sid)) {
+               sid_append_rid(&adm_sid, DOMAIN_USER_RID_ADMIN);
+
+               sa = PRINTER_ACE_FULL_CONTROL;
+               init_sec_ace(&ace[i++], &adm_sid,
+                       SEC_ACE_TYPE_ACCESS_ALLOWED, sa,
+                       SEC_ACE_FLAG_OBJECT_INHERIT | SEC_ACE_FLAG_INHERIT_ONLY);
+               init_sec_ace(&ace[i++], &adm_sid, SEC_ACE_TYPE_ACCESS_ALLOWED,
+                       sa, SEC_ACE_FLAG_CONTAINER_INHERIT);
+       }
+
+       /* add BUILTIN\Administrators as FULL CONTROL */
+
+       sa = PRINTER_ACE_FULL_CONTROL;
+       init_sec_ace(&ace[i++], &global_sid_Builtin_Administrators,
+               SEC_ACE_TYPE_ACCESS_ALLOWED, sa,
+               SEC_ACE_FLAG_OBJECT_INHERIT | SEC_ACE_FLAG_INHERIT_ONLY);
+       init_sec_ace(&ace[i++], &global_sid_Builtin_Administrators,
+               SEC_ACE_TYPE_ACCESS_ALLOWED,
+               sa, SEC_ACE_FLAG_CONTAINER_INHERIT);
+
+       /* Make the security descriptor owned by the BUILTIN\Administrators */
+
+       /* The ACL revision number in rpc_secdesc.h differs from the one
+          created by NT when setting ACE entries in printer
+          descriptors.  NT4 complains about the property being edited by a
+          NT5 machine. */
+
+       if ((psa = make_sec_acl(ctx, NT4_ACL_REVISION, i, ace)) != NULL) {
+               psd = make_sec_desc(ctx, SEC_DESC_REVISION, SEC_DESC_SELF_RELATIVE,
+                       &global_sid_Builtin_Administrators,
+                       &global_sid_Builtin_Administrators,
+                       NULL, psa, &sd_size);
+       }
+
+       if (!psd) {
+               DEBUG(0,("construct_default_printer_sd: Failed to make SEC_DESC.\n"));
+               return NULL;
+       }
+
+       DEBUG(4,("construct_default_printer_sdb: size = %u.\n",
+                (unsigned int)sd_size));
+
+       return psd;
+}
